Ticket: PAY-3318 — Config drift on idempotency keys

The Tollgrim retry worker in staging diverged from prod: key TTL and prefix scheme differ, causing duplicate charge retries during testing. Do not hand-edit staging again; all changes go through the Ferrow pipeline. Canonical configuration values for the service follow.

service settings:
quenath:
  log_level: info
  metrics_host: metrics.quenath.tolvaqlabs.internal
  pin: 1407
  pool_size: 8

Q3 Planning Note — Hedging

Board, quick one: with the Veldmark krona wobbling, Treasury wants to lock 60% of our expected Oster Group receivables via forwards rather than ride it out. Costs us a bit of upside, saves us the heartburn we had last spring. Maret will table the instruments at the next session. One confidential item on our plans follows below.

internal memo for kawip-hadug: Headcount on the Wenwyn team goes from 7 to 140 by the end of January. Gross margin on Wenwyn came in at 20 percent against a plan of 15 percent.

**Q: Why do converted amounts sometimes come out a cent off?**

A: Classic rounding issue. Frondle converts currencies using six-decimal rates, but we round to two decimals at display time, so sums of line items can drift by a cent. Always round once, at the final total — never per line. The full rounding policy with worked examples is on the internal page here.

wiki page, bagaf-fawip: https://harbor.tolvaqsys.local/pages/repo/pages/secrets/eac969ffc71f356b

### Release Checklist — Item 7: Flockrender transcode farm warm-up

Before promoting the new Flockrender worker image, confirm all six encode pools have pulled it and completed at least one canary job per codec profile. Check that queue depth stays under 200 for fifteen minutes post-switch. If any pool lags, roll that pool back individually rather than the whole farm. Record in the handoff log the build token, shown below.

pipeline stamp: htk9_ce63042d9